Block
#8,987,455
156w
42 txs4,644,954 confs
Transactions
42
Total Output
₳2,119,663.3
$380.82K
Fees
₳12.92
Size
79.39 KB
81,294 bytes
Details
Hash
7a5df9855aa6fd6e8c7bbfce45461a625d868ebab2fdc607e5ba594a93994dae
Epoch / Slot
Epoch 421 · slot 96,930,645 · epoch-slot 421,845
Timestamp
156w · Tue, 04 Jul 2023 18:55:36 GMT
Block producer
VRF key
vrf_vk16…9stjmj5a
Op cert
defb7253…dc760234
Op cert counter
9
Transactions in block30